After having lost a blowout in their  previous game against Concord Christian, Georgia Force Christian was happy to have turned things around  on Friday. They claimed a resounding  31-0 win over the Anderson C Cavaliers. The  victory continues a trend for the Blue Knights in their matchups with the Cavaliers: they've now won eight in a row.
 Brady Brown had a dynamite game, rushing for 57 yards and two  TDs on only six carries.
 Georgia Force Christian didn't go easy on the quarterback and picked off three passes before the game was over. The picks came courtesy of  Tyler Veugeler and  Mike Tyson. Tyson got in on the action too, converting a pick  into a touchdown.
Georgia Force Christian's win bumped their record up to 5-3. As for Anderson C,  they are  on  a  four-game losing streak  that has dropped them down to 1-6.
 Georgia Force Christian has already played their next contest,  a  36-0  victory against Baker County on the 24th. As for Anderson C, they also wasted no time getting back out on the field and have already played their next  game,  an  18-7  win against Clear Dot Charter on the 24th.
